Practical Tips for Using Haunter Effectively

To get the most out of Haunter, consider the following tips:

  1. Use it strategically: Reserve Haunter for headings, logos, or accents rather than for long blocks of text. This ensures it enhances rather than overwhelms your design.
  2. Test across devices: Make sure Haunter looks good on both desktop and mobile screens. Some fonts render differently depending on the device or browser, so always check how it appears in real-world conditions.
  3. Pair wisely: If you're using Haunter alongside another font, choose one that complements its style. Sans-serif fonts like Arial or Helvetica can provide a nice contrast and balance.
  4. Check licensing: Before downloading or using Haunter, verify the licensing terms. Some fonts require payment or have restrictions on commercial use. Always ensure you're allowed to use it for your intended purpose.

Real-World Examples and Better Approaches

Imagine you're designing a poster for a music festival. Using Haunter for the event name will immediately grab attention with its bold and dynamic look. However, if you also use Haunter for the venue details and dates, the overall design might become too busy and hard to read. Instead, pair Haunter with a simpler sans-serif font for the supporting information to keep everything clear and focused.

Another example is using Haunter in a digital newsletter. While it can work well for the subject line or headline, using it for the entire email body would likely confuse readers. Stick to using it for key elements and let a more readable font handle the rest of the content.
